Youth Conservation Internships

Working with Nature for a Bright Future

Offered in partnership with the Hampton Roads Workforce Council, our 8-week Youth Conservation Internship program links Portsmouth high school students with mentors in river-friendly horticulture, sustainable landscape design and more. Along the way, they earn a certification as a Chesapeake Bay Landscaping Professional Associate and develop a lifelong appreciation for the natural world. The program is held at Paradise Creek Nature Park.

What Youth Conservation Interns Learn

Teambuilding

Interns work in teams to learn about the river and its surrounding environment. Each intern develops skills to lead volunteers, including military, students and the community.

Life Skills

Mentors offer insightful lectures, conversations and hands-on learning opportunities to keep interns learning and engaged.

Appreciation for Nature

Each Intern learns first-hand about biodiversity, conservation, the impact humans have on the river, and how everyone can become an agent of positive change.

Job Skills

Interns gain valuable job skills through hands-on learning in horticulture, landscape design, landscape maintenance and outdoor leadership education.

Certified Fun

Youth Conservation Interns become certified Chesapeake Bay Landscape Professional Associates by completing this entry-level certificate course that introduces students to green infrastructure and training on sustainable landscaping practices that help restore the Chesapeake Bay and our cherished waterways.
